he Onion'' recently conducted a survey of 50 families, and found that 95% of them were in a heated debate about the ideal sleeping location for cats. Compute the 90% confidence interval for the proportion of families who are in a heated debate about the ideal sleeping location for cats.

We have n = sample size = 50

p^ = sample proportion = 0.95

The 90% confidence interval for population proportion p

p^ - Z​​​​​​a/2* sqrt [p*q/n ] < p < p^ + Z​​​​​​a/2* sqrt [ p*q/n]

For a = 0.10 , Z​​​​​0.05 = 1.645

0.95 - 1.645*sqrt[0.95*0.05/50] < p < 0.95 + 1.645*sqrt[0.95*0.05/50]

0.95 - 0.051 < p < 0.95 + 0.051

0.899 < p < 1.001

So 90% confidence intervalfor the proportion of families who are in a heated debate about the ideal sleeping location for cats is (0.899,1.001)
